+struct symdiff {
+ struct bitmap *skip;
+ int warn;
+ const char *base, *left, *right;
+};
+
+/*
+ * Check for symmetric-difference arguments, and if present, arrange
+ * everything we need to know to handle them correctly. As a bonus,
+ * weed out all bogus range-based revision specifications, e.g.,
+ * "git diff A..B C..D" or "git diff A..B C" get rejected.
+ *
+ * For an actual symmetric diff, *symdiff is set this way:
+ *
+ * - its skip is non-NULL and marks *all* rev->pending.objects[i]
+ * indices that the caller should ignore (extra merge bases, of
+ * which there might be many, and A in A...B). Note that the
+ * chosen merge base and right side are NOT marked.
+ * - warn is set if there are multiple merge bases.
+ * - base, left, and right point to the names to use in a
+ * warning about multiple merge bases.
+ *
+ * If there is no symmetric diff argument, sym->skip is NULL and
+ * sym->warn is cleared. The remaining fields are not set.
+ */
